Buying a home in Opelika, Alabama, means you get to choose between two very different but equally appealing worlds: the charm of history and the ease of modern living. Unlike nearby Auburn, where many historic homes have been replaced by large apartment complexes, Opelika still proudly showcases its architectural heritage. From early 1900s cottages downtown to sleek new builds in family-friendly communities, there’s something here for every lifestyle.

Understanding Opelika’s Historic Homes
